What is a Tesla Card Key?
A Tesla Card Key is a physical keycard that allows you to unlock and start your Tesla vehicle without using your phone or a traditional key fob. It’s a convenient and secure way to access your car, especially if you forget your phone or experience connectivity issues.
How does a Tesla Card Key work?
The Tesla Card Key utilizes near-field communication (NFC) technology. When you bring the card close to the designated area on your Tesla’s door handle, it transmits a signal that unlocks the car. To start the vehicle, you’ll need to place the card on the designated spot on the center console. The car recognizes the card and allows you to start the engine. What if my Tesla Card Key is lost or stolen?
If your Tesla Card Key is lost or stolen, you can remotely deactivate it through your Tesla account. This will prevent unauthorized access to your vehicle. You can also order a replacement card key through Tesla.
